The Lakewood Theater Company is the local theater production that was established over three decades ago. It houses a theater which consists of modern light and sound facilities where shows of various genres are regularly scheduled. Patrons praise the place for the enthralling performances put by the actors. If you want to be a part of the acting team you can enroll for the auditions which are hosted by the committee.
One of the oldest plantation houses in Goodlettsville, the Bowen-Campbell House was built in 1788 by Captain William Bowen, a decorated war veteran who served the nation during the American Revolutionary War of 1775. The house was later occupied by Brigadier General William Bowen Campbell, his grandson, giving the house its present name. The house was donated to the Tennessee Historical Commission which converted it into a house museum in 1996.
